16 changes: 16 additions & 0 deletions internal/store/deployment.go
Original file line number Diff line number Diff line change
Expand Up @@ -267,6 +267,22 @@ func deploymentMetricFamilies(allowAnnotationsList, allowLabelsList []string) []
}
}),
),
*generator.NewFamilyGeneratorWithStability(
"kube_deployment_spec_topology_spread_constraints",
"Number of topology spread constraints in the deployment's pod template.",
metric.Gauge,
basemetrics.STABLE,
"",
wrapDeploymentFunc(func(d *v1.Deployment) *metric.Family {
return &metric.Family{
Metrics: []*metric.Metric{
{
Value: float64(len(d.Spec.Template.Spec.TopologySpreadConstraints)),
},
},
}
}),
),
